I don't know about you but I believe every gardener has their nemesis plant. That plant that just never does well no matter what you do. 

For me it's passionfruit.  Everytime I try to grow one it goes gangbusters for the first season. Is great over winter. Bursts into life in spring then it curls up and dies. I never get 2 seasons.

I spray with copper. Plant in a free draining soil. Don't over or underwater. It just doesn't like me. 

The annoying thing is that I drove past our last house and the ones I planted before we left are now 3 years old and spilling over the fence. 

Anyway, some good news. Our bug motel is now occupied and the Monach butterfly caterpillars are doing great.
